Focus on Symmetry
You might be unsurprised to learn that the human brain finds symmetry soothing, as it can appear safe and efficient.
For this reason, many professional interior designers often use symmetry to elevate an interior design and create a more comfortable environment.
To follow in their footsteps, place your headboard in the center of the wall, and add two matching table lamps to two identical nightstands, which should flank the bed.
Also, add even pairs of pillows to the bed, starting with two large pillows followed by two medium pillows, and two smaller pillows in varying fabrics and sizes.
If you want to steer away from a mirrored interior design style, echo a specific shape in the bedroom instead. For instance, you can add balance by pairing a round stool or circular accessory with a round mirror.

Soften Sounds
Silence is important in a bedroom. If you are tired of hearing loud traffic, noisy neighbors, or general household noise when you step inside the space, aim to incorporate stylish items that will soften external sounds and provide some much-needed peace and quiet.
For instance, premium velvet curtains will add a touch of grandeur and texture to your interior while dampening noise and blocking light. It will help create a quiet, tranquil, and attractive retreat in the home.
In addition to hanging curtains, lay down a large rug to reduce noise in your bedroom while minimizing the sound of footsteps. Look for a rug that covers 70% of your floor space to reduce your bedroom’s acoustics.
Alter Your Bedroom Layout
You might not realize it, but your bedroom layout can determine your mood, comfort, and the interior’s aesthetic appeal.
According to Feng Shui, it is best to place your bed in a position where you can see the door without being directly in front of it.
It is a popular choice among interior designers, as the bed will become a clear focal point and makes people feel subconsciously safer and less stressed.
